  • How to prepare for Converting UNIX shell scripts to PL/SQL

    Hi All
    I was said, that i may have to convert a lot of unix shell script to PL/SQL, what are the concepts i need to know to do it efficently,
    what are the options PL/SQL is having to best do that.
    I know the question is little unclear, but I too dont have much inputs about that i'm sorry for that, just its a question of how
    to prepare myself to do it the best way. What are the concepts i have to be familiar with.
    Many Thanks
    MJ

    Just how much work is involved, is hard to say. Many years ago I also wrote (more than once) a complete ETL system using a combination of shell scripts, SQL*Plus and PL/SQL.
    If the PL/SQL code is fairly clean, uses bind variables and not substitution variables, then it should be relatively easy to convert that PL/SQL code in the script to a formal stored procedure in the database.
    There is however bits and pieces that will be difficult to move into the PL/SQL layer as it requires new software - like for example FTP'ing a file from the production server to the ETL server. This can be done using external o/s calls from within PL/SQL. Or, you can install a FTP API library in PL/SQL and FTP that file directly into a CLOB and parse and process the CLOB.
    Think of Oracle as an o/s in its own right. In Oracle we have a mail client, a web browser, IPC methods like pipes and messages queues, cron, file systems, web servers and services, etc. And PL/SQL is the "shell scripting" (times a thousand) language of this Oracle o/s .
    In some cases you will find it fairly easy to map a Unix o/s feature or command to one in Oracle. For example, a Unix wget to fetch a HTML CSV file can easily be replaced in Oracle using a UTL_HTTP call.
    On the other hand, techniques used in Unix like creating a pipe to process data, grep for certain stuff and awk certain tokens for sed to process further... in Oracle this will look and work a lot different and use SQL.
